Трансляція коду Delphi в код C + + Builder, Різне, Програмування, статті

Мета цієї статті полягає в тому, щоб допомогти вам зрозуміти основні відмінності і подібності між C + + і Object Pascal (мова, що використовується в Delphi від Borland), і допомогти вам в перетворенні проекту написаного на Delphi в проект написаний на C + + (С + + Builder від Borland). В жалбнейшем в цій статті […]

Форсоване тестування процедур T-SQL, Інші СУБД, Бази даних, статті

Використання динамічних запитів і web-звітів для автоматизації тестів Раніше тестування процедур, як правило, було заключній «санітарної» перевіркою перед випуском нової процедури: чи чітко працює процедура і чи виконує всі покладені на неї завдання? Якщо відповідь позитивний, то можна випускати процедуру і рухатися далі. Тільки у деяких адміністраторів баз даних знаходилося час зайнятися нетиповими сценаріями використання, […]

Кілька прийомів роботи з базами даних, Різне, Програмування, статті

Автор: Сергій Дуплік, Королівство Delphi Дана стаття призначена в основному для тих, хто починає працювати з базами даних. Тут зібрані прийоми, спрямовані на оптимізацію та прискорення роботи з базами даних. Описані приклади є результатом багаторічної роботи автора з СУБД MS SQL Server, Oracle і Access. Приклади описуються в загальному вигляді, без прив’язки до якоїсь конкретної […]

Загальний план оптимізації і настройки запитів SQL Server, Інші СУБД, Бази даних, статті

Під час недавнього співбесіди, яка я проходив, щоб знайти нову роботу раніше, ніж закінчиться мій поточний контракт, мені задали питання, яке захопив мене зненацька. Інтерв’юер просто запитав мене, які кроки я б зробив, щоб з’ясувати, які збережені процедури потребують оптимізації, і що я зазвичай роблю для оптимізації запитів. Мене застав зненацька не саме питання, а […]

Створення пользовательсткіх класів в Access, MS Office, Програмні керівництва, статті

Загальні визначення Спочатку визначимося: що ж таке об’єкт в розумінні об’єктно-орієнтованого програмування. У самому простому (життєвому) розумінні об’єкт – Це якась річ, і так само як і в навколишньому світі, об’єкт має властивості (“камінь твердий”) і операції, які виконуються над цими властивостями (камінь можна розбити). Майже так само йде справа і з об’єктами в світі […]

Borland IB Database FAQ, Інші СУБД, Бази даних, статті

Цей документ містить найбільш часто надану інформацію по Borland IB Database. Содержание: 1.1 Працює-ли IB з російськими буквами? 1.2 Я встановив Delphi 2.0 C / S, але чомусь використання російських кодувань призводить до помилки? 1.3 Чому таблиця або select показиваетс в Grid швидко, а переміщення в кінець таблиці відбувається довго?

Використання mdb файлу як бібліотеки функцій, MS Office, Програмні керівництва, статті

Можна з одного проекту (далі А) встановити посилання на інший проект(Далі Б) і використовувати універсальні процедури і функції з нього (Б). Це зручно при розробці нового проекту і, особливо, якщо в комплексі використовується основний і допоміжні проекти. Наприклад, “Облік товару “і” Взаєморозрахунки з постачальниками“.

Створення користувальницьких класів в Access, Інші СУБД, Бази даних, статті

Загальні визначення Спочатку визначимося: що ж таке об’єкт в розумінні об’єктно-орієнтованого програмування. У самому простому (життєвому) розумінні об’єкт – Це якась річ, і так само як і в навколишньому світі, об’єкт має властивості (“камінь твердий”) і операції, які виконуються над цими властивостями (камінь можна розбити). Майже так само йде справа і з об’єктами в світі […]

VBA в Microsoft Access, MS Office, Програмні керівництва, статті

Більшість додатків, поширюваних серед користувачів, містить той чи інший обсяг коду VBA (Visual Basic for Applications). Оскільки VBA є єдиним засобом для виконання багатьох стандартних завдань в Access (робота зі змінними, побудова команд SQL під час роботи програми, обробка помилок, використання Windows API і т. д.), багатьом розробникам рано чи пізно доводиться розбиратися в тонкощах […]

Документи Office 2000 і їхні проекти. Об’єктна модель і програмна робота з програмними проектами, Basic, Програмування, статті

Володимир Білліг, VBstep.ru Усюди, де тільки можна, я не втомлювався повторювати, як заклинання, що для офісного програміста метою роботи є створення документа, частиною якого є програмний проект, нерозривно пов’язаний з документом. Більш того, в серйозних розробках мова завжди йде про створення системи документів, а, отже, і про систему програмних проектів, пов’язаних з цими документами, так […]